中文摘要 | Present compilers generated by the compiler infrastructures gives an insufficient support to the architecture related optimizations. An executable optimizer generation framework (EOGF) was developed, which gives an improved code quality for embedded application systems. With compiler infrastructures such as GCC (GNU compiler collection), the EOGF can quickly compose an integrated generation environment for high quality compilers. The EOGF can also improve the final code quality by taking advantage of the special machine characteristics. Experimental results show that the EOGF can flexibly and efficiently generate executable optimizers. |
